Historical grants to 15 recipients across 8 states. Top concentrations: NEW YORK ($250K, 1 grant), HARTFORD ($125K, 2 grants), NOTRE DAME ($125K, 1 grant), WESTPORT ($100K, 3 grants), WINSTONSALEM ($60K, 1 grant).
